Output 0ddaa2b689ac27f4d85266b6ff4c33fd19d0e589de3a3f71e0903eb48e5937da:1

value
1054196
script pubkey
OP_0 OP_PUSHBYTES_32 380513074b40f3d6ec56733645bde24752f6d014f47f5bd6e1bdc846c506cf6a
address
bc1q8qz3xp6tgreadmzkwvmyt00zgaf0d5q573l4h4hphhyyd3gxea4qrm53nn
transaction
0ddaa2b689ac27f4d85266b6ff4c33fd19d0e589de3a3f71e0903eb48e5937da
spent
true